Relocation Bracketts- How?

I purchased a set of Eibach Pro-kit 1.3" lowering springs and the
relocation bracketts, for my 95 Z28 LT1.
Since I am not mechanically inclined, I asked the Chev. Dealer what the cost would be to install. Did not get a precise answer, and some concern about their competence.
What is involved in welding the brackets, and how long should it take a
competent mechanic to do the job.....Thanks

Re: Relocation Bracketts- How?

Weld-in or bolt-in?

I doubt the average "Chev. dealer" would have the slightest idea what an "LCA relocaton bracket" even is.

Really shouldn't take more than 15-20 minutes per side. If they are "bolt-in", you should be able to do it yourself. Its the welding part that is the problem. Any competent welder should be able to take care of that.
